Goalkeeper Sergio Rico's wife posts message that her husband is in critical condition

Báo Thanh niênBáo Thanh niên30/05/2023


Goalkeeper Sergio Rico, 29, from Spain, fell off a horse and was kicked in the neck last Sunday. He was rushed to the Virgen del Rocio hospital in Seville by helicopter in critical condition.

Goalkeeper Sergio Rico of PSG Club

After nearly a day of emergency care, goalkeeper Sergio Rico's family released a statement on Monday (May 29): "Sergio Rico is stable and in good condition. However, everything must still be extremely careful, especially in the next 48 hours."

On the afternoon of May 30 (Vietnam time), a few hours ago, goalkeeper Sergio Rico's wife, Alba Silva, posted a status that is causing much concern in the football world. "Please don't leave me alone, my love, because I swear I can't. I don't know how to live without you. We love you so much," Alba Silva wrote on Instagram. Along with this message, Alba Silva also posted a black and white photo with goalkeeper Sergio Rico on their wedding day.

Images and messages from goalkeeper Sergio Rico's wife are causing concern in the football world

Goalkeeper Sergio Rico and Alba Silva got married last year and have a son together. Sergio Rico previously played for Fulham in the Premier League in the 2018-2019 season, after leaving Sevilla.

Sergio Rico joined PSG on loan in September 2019 before signing a long-term contract (4 years) in September 2020 for a transfer fee of 6 million euros. He also spent time on loan at Mallorca before returning to the Paris club this season, but only as a backup to No. 1 goalkeeper Gianluigi Donnarumma.

Last weekend, Sergio Rico was also on the bench as PSG drew 1-1 away to Strasbourg, just enough to win the Ligue 1 title. After this match, coach Christophe Galtier gave PSG players a day off until early this week to return to training. However, on his day off, Sergio Rico returned to his home country of Spain and had an accident.
